Touring cycling routes around Obrowo, located in the Kuyavian-Pomeranian Voivodeship, offer diverse terrain primarily characterized by the flat Vistula River Valley. The region provides access to extensive forest complexes, such as the Tuchola Forest, and numerous lakes, creating varied cycling environments. Routes often follow established bike paths and quiet local roads, with some sections featuring gravel surfaces. The landscape includes river oxbows and forested areas, providing scenic views for cyclists.

Observation terrace named after Michał Kokot, an artist associated with Osiek nad Wisłą, including a former photojournalist for "Nowości" and "Gazeta Pomorska". The area is tidy, there are many benches, a place for a bonfire, and garbage cans.

Czernikowo 700th Anniversary Park, which was created on the site of a former marketplace.

Translated by Google

0

0

On the occasion of the 100th anniversary of Poland regaining independence, the Fowler Shooting Brotherhood of the Dobrzyń Land, together with the Czernikowo Commune, built the Independence Monument, which was placed in the Czernikowo 700th Anniversary Park. In this way, the Brotherhood paid tribute to all those who fought for the freedom of their homeland.

What are some interesting landmarks or historical sites to explore near Obrowo while cycling?

While cycling near Obrowo, you can discover several interesting landmarks. Consider visiting the Railway Bridge over the Vistula (Toruń) or the Bridge Over the Mień River. For history enthusiasts, the Fort IV Stanisława Żółkiewskiego (Toruń Fortress) and the Ruins of the Teutonic Castle in Toruń offer glimpses into the region's past. The Nieszawa Market Square is also a charming stop.
